So without further ado, here’s what Lee predicts (Last update 6/8/2015);
Friday will see plenty of sunshine with mainly light winds, cloud will bubble up in the afternoon and this could produce the odd shower.Temperatures reaching 20c
Saturday will start fine and bright after a cool night, cloud will spread across later in the morning bringing a little light rain towards the end of the afternoon and through the evening. Temperatures reaching 19c.
Sunday will see a lot of cloud with a few light showers at first but on the whole a bright, warm day with highs of 19c once again.
